Using OCR to enter graphics as text into a clipboard

Computer graphics processing and selective visual display system – Display driving control circuitry – Controlling the condition of display elements

Reexamination Certificate

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

C345S215000, C345S215000, C382S182000, C382S187000, C707S793000, C707S793000

Reexamination Certificate

active

06249283

ABSTRACT:

TECHNICAL FIELD
The present invention relates to information processing systems such as personal computers or workstations and more particularly to a system for transferring any type of displayed data, from one application program to another application program.
BACKGROUND ART
A very common feature within application programs such as word-processors or text editors within graphical user interfaces (GUI) such as window-based environments, is the ability for the user to use functions that allow to transfer text or characters in general from one place to another. Examples of such functions are the well-known cut-and-paste or copy-and-paste functions. These functions basically use a buffer memory (often referred to as a clipboard) for storing the text or characters that are to be copied or transferred from one place to another within the same application program or to another application program when feasible. The common way for selecting a portion of a screen to be copied or moved, is to use a selecting device such as a mouse that the user drags over the portion of the screen being selected while pressing one of the mouse's button. When the desired portion of the screen is selected, normally that portion is highlighted, then, the user moves the mouse to the screen location where the selected portion is to be transferred and presses another mouse button for achieving the transfer. While the mouse is the most common selecting device used, in some applications the selection is done using the keyboard (e.g. the VI editor in UNIX environment).
With some applications e.g. some text editors, the user is provided with cut-and-paste or copy-and-paste functions that work only within the same application but not for transferring data to another application. Generally, this happens when the application uses its own clipboard, which is distinct from the operating system's clipboard.
In some other applications such as graphics/image display applications (such as applications accessed through the Internet network), the user is generally not provided with any such functions. If this is the case, the user will have to print the screen or manually copy the text that he wants to keep a record of. Considering the important development of graphical applications e.g. within the Internet network whereby the user may want to store or catch information, it would be very useful for the user to be provided with a system that would offer the capability of a copy/cut-and-paste function that is usable in any window-based application, that displays text or graphics, for transferring portions of screen into a file or to another portion of the screen within or not the same application.
SUMMARY OF THE INVENTION
The object of the present invention is to provide a system for moving a displayed text from application to application when support is not provided and more particularly when the displayed text is issued from a graphic application.
According to the invention this object is achieved in a computer system including operating system with a graphical user interface responsive to a user input device by having: an information transfer means, activated in response to a user action on the input device, for identifying a user selected source of textual information, and for transferring textual information from the selected source as an image into a first predetermined location of the computer system's memory; and an optical character recognition logic (OCR) coupled to the information transfer means, for generating a character code for each character image identified in said image stored in the first predetermined location, the generated character codes being stored afterwards by the information transfer means into a second predetermined location of the computer memory whereby said source information is rendered available to an application program by being inserted into a user defined screen location.
Preferably the arrangement for transferring information into an application program is implemented by an application software program.
Viewed from another aspect, the present invention provides a method for transferring information into an application program of a computer system, the method comprising: identifying a portion of the display screen, the portion being selected by a user action on an input device, and storing said selected portion of the screen as a bit image into a first predefined location of the memory; detecting character images in the stored bit image and generating a coded representation of a character sequence from the detected character images, the detection and generation substeps being carried out by an optical character recognition logic, and storing the coded representation of a character sequence into a second predetermined location of the computer memory; and inserting the coded representation of a character sequence into a user selected location of the display screen by a user action on the input device, the location being operated by an application program.


REFERENCES:
patent: 5386564 (1995-01-01), Shearer et al.
patent: 5621878 (1997-04-01), Owens et al.
patent: 5659791 (1997-08-01), Nakajima et al.
patent: 5850480 (1998-12-01), Scanlon
patent: 5881381 (1999-03-01), Yamashita et al.
patent: 5889518 (1999-03-01), Poreh et al.

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Using OCR to enter graphics as text into a clipboard does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Using OCR to enter graphics as text into a clipboard,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Using OCR to enter graphics as text into a clipboard will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-2437341

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.